清理程序可以根据不同的需求和场景来编写。以下是一个简单的Windows系统清理批处理文件示例,用于清理系统临时文件、回收站内容以及一些常见缓存和日志文件:
```batch
@echo off
echo 正在清除系统垃圾文件,请稍等......
del /f /s /q %systemdrive%\*.tmp
del /f /s /q %systemdrive%\*._mp
del /f /s /q %systemdrive%\*.log
del /f /s /q %systemdrive%\*.gid
del /f /s /q %systemdrive%\*.chk
del /f /s /q %systemdrive%\*.old
del /f /s /q %systemdrive%\recycled\*.*
del /f /s /q %windir%\*.bak
del /f /s /q %windir%\prefetch\*.*
rd /s /q %windir%\temp
md %windir%\temp
del /f /q %userprofile%\cookies\*.*
del /f /q %userprofile%\recent\*.*
del /f /s /q "%userprofile%\Local Settings\Temporary Internet Files\*.*"
del /f /s /q "%userprofile%\Local Settings\Temp\*.*"
del /f /s /q "%userprofile%\recent\*.*"
echo 清除系统垃圾完成!
pause
```
将以上代码复制到一个文本文件中,然后将文件保存为“磁盘清理.bat”(确保文件扩展名为.bat)。双击运行该批处理文件,它将自动执行上述命令,清理系统中的临时文件和缓存。
如果你需要针对特定应用程序或更复杂的清理任务编写清理程序,可能需要更详细的步骤和命令。此外,对于非Windows系统,清理程序可能需要使用不同的命令和语法。